關於json時間資料格式轉換與修改

2022-09-03 12:42:11 字數 1035 閱讀 9492

使用easyui獲取json時間資料時間資料時,通常是一長串的數字而不是我們想要的類似2018-11-01的普通時間格式。

此時我們就需要使用到關於json時間的格式化,而將時間轉化成我們想要的格式。

一般轉化格式

之前一直使用的  tolocaledatestring()  但是用著用著發現了bug,不同瀏覽器對於 tolocaledatestring()  的解析結果不同,所以很容易造成前一天除錯好發現顯示正常了,等到第二天又會出現時間格式問題。

後面就換了一種方法,發現這個方法確實要比  tolocaledatestring()  更合適。

話不多說,直接上**吧

}} //使用的是easyui-datagrid資料網格

function formatterdate(val, row)

這樣處理過後就能將時間正常的顯示出來了。當然這個轉化函式也可以直接在寫在  field 中,不過為了**的美觀,還是推薦寫在外部。

格式化後在進行行內編輯的時候,發現轉化後的時間無法在啟動修改編輯時,對 datebox 進行賦值,同時這時候 datebox 選定的日期無法傳輸到後台。

這時候舉要使用到jquery 的$.extend 方法 對 datagrid 的editors 進行繼承擴充套件

1

$.extend($.fn.datagrid.defaults.editors, ,

8 destroy : function

(target) ,

11 getvalue : function

(target) ,

14 setvalue : function

(target, value) ,

18 resize : function

(target, width) 21}

22 });

這樣處理過後的時間就能夠進行一系列的操作了,

時間資料格式的轉換與計算

1 時間點的格式化字串輸出 導包 from datetime import datetime 2 日期的運算 導包 from datetime import timedelta import time from datetime import datetime 1.時間戳 time.time tim...

SpringMVC中時間資料格式問題

springmvc中對於時間欄位的處理經常會遇到格式問題,大體有兩種情況,第一種是提交表單時時間格式錯誤,表單提交不上出。第二種是資料返回時,前台頁面只能顯示乙個長整數。下面針對這兩個問題分別給出相應的解決方法 1.提交表單問題。在後台實體類時間字段加入 datetimeformat pattern...

Json資料格式

在web 系統開發中,經常會碰到客戶端和伺服器端互動的問題,比如說客戶端傳送乙個 ajax 請求,然後在伺服器端進行計算,計算後返回結果,客戶端接收到這個響應結果並對它進行處理。那麼這個結果以一種什麼資料結構返回,客戶端才能比較容易和較好的處理呢?通過幾個專案的實踐,我發現 json 格式的資料是一...